Director Of Software Engineering – Common Interview Questions & Answers

 thumbnail

Director Of Software Engineering – Common Interview Questions & Answers

Published Mar 17, 25
8 min read
[=headercontent]How To Handle Multiple Faang Job Offers – Tips For Candidates [/headercontent] [=image]
Preparing For Your Full Loop Interview At Meta – What To Expect

How To Make A Standout Faang Software Engineer Portfolio




[/video]

Have foundation; disagree and devote"Leaders are bound to pleasantly test decisions when they differ, also when doing so is unpleasant or tiring. Leaders have sentence and are steadfast. They do not jeopardize for social communication. As soon as a choice is identified, they devote wholly."Any kind of team of smart leaders will differ at some time. At the exact same time, they would like to know you can sense the correct time to progress despite your argument. Invent and streamline" Leaders expect and need technology and invention from their teams and constantly locate ways to simplify. They are externally conscious, search for new concepts from anywhere, and are not restricted by" not developed here."Because we do brand-new things, we accept that we may be misconstrued for extended periods of time. "Amazon relies upon a culture of advancement. Interviewers intend to see that you are thrilled to dive deep when troubles develop.

Tell me regarding a task in which you needed to deep study evaluation Tell me concerning one of the most complex issue you have dealt with Describe a circumstances when you made use of a great deal of data in a short amount of time Are right, a lot"Leaders are right a great deal. They believe differently and look around edges for means to offer customers." Amazon is significant and its SDEs need to construct products that get to significant range to make a difference for business. As an outcome, job interviewers will intend to see that you can create and verbalize a strong vision. Why was it significant? Hire and develop the very best"Leaders elevate the performance bar with every hire and promotion. They recognize exceptional skill, and voluntarily move them throughout the company. Leaders create leaders and take seriously their function in mentoring others. We work with part of our individuals to design mechanisms for growth like Occupation Choice."As stated over, Amazon desires new hires to"increase bench. "Recruiters will desire to see that you are not scared of dealing with and working with individuals smarter than you. You'll notice the examples provided below are general interview inquiries, however they give a best chance for you to address this concept.

This leadership concept is normally discussed in meetings for extremely senior design positions that entail individuals management or building a group(e.g. Software Growth Supervisor, Director, and so on ). At every touchpoint, Amazon tries to offer consumers with as much value for as little cost as possible. Some examples detailed here are basic interview inquiries, yet they offer a best chance for you to address this principle.

They lead with compassion, have fun at the office, and make it simple for others to have a good time. Leaders ask themselves: Are my fellow employees growing? Are they empowered? Are they ready for what's next? Leaders have a vision for and commitment to their workers'personal success, whether that go to Amazon or in other places. "Comparable to the principle" hire and develop the ideal," this principle is a lot more most likely ahead up in meetings for elderly and/or supervisory settings. We allow, we impact the globe, and we are far from excellent. We need to be modest and thoughtful about even the secondary results of our actions. Our local areas , world, and future generations need us to be much better each day. We should begin each day with a resolution to make much better, do far better, and be much better for our consumers, our staff members, our partners, and the world at big. You have to constantly be eager to boost. Give me an instance of when you chose that affected the team or the firm Can you inform me a decision that you made regarding your job that you regret now? In many cases, if you're a fresh graduate applicant, you may also get inquiries on computer science basics as stated in this Medium short article. You could be an amazing software program engineer, however regrettably, that will not be adequate to ace your interviews at Amazon. Interviewing is a skill in itself, that you require to discover. Allow's look at some essential suggestions to make certain you approach your meetings in properly. Frequently the questions you'll be asked will be quite uncertain, so make certain you ask inquiries that can aid you clear up and comprehend the trouble. Constantly make use of particular information and never generalize.

The Best Mock Interview Platforms For Faang Tech Prep

The 3-month Coding Interview Preparation Bootcamp – Is It Worth It?


The very best means to do this is to prepare a single specific example of a previous experience to illustrate your response to a concern. When discussing your previous success, Bilwasiva, Amazon interview coach recommends quantifying your success wherever feasible."Use metrics and information to demonstrate the influence of your contributions. "You require to stroll your interviewer through your mind before you actually begin coding.

The Best Online Platforms For Faang Coding Interview Preparation

or creating a system. Your interviewer might likewise give you tips regarding whether you're on the right track or not. In your system design interview, you need to clearly mention presumptions and get in touch with your recruiter to see if those presumptions are affordable. When you code, existing numerous possible services if you can. Amazon would like to know your thinking forchoosing a certain option. While we mentioned the first 4 values as the ones given emphasis in SDE interviews, the very best means to prepare is to contend the very least one story for each LP. To be extra efficient, you can adjust your tales so they can respond to numerous leadership principles. Keep your code organized so your recruiter won't have a difficult time recognizing what you have actually composed. While your code won't be examined, you'll be extra excellent if you create testable code. Prepare to describe the Time/Space Intricacy of your services, and how to better optimize for Time/Space Complexity. Do not use random/variable feature names. Be sure to write descriptive, purposeful ones. Amazon recommends SDE prospects to be prepared to compose code in real-time on an online editor. You can consult your recruiter which it will be if you're unsure which medium to make use of. Currently that you recognize what questions to anticipate, allow's concentrate on how to.

prepare. Right here are the 4 preparation steps we recommend to assist you obtain a deal as an Amazon (or Amazon Internet Solutions)software program advancement designer. If you recognize engineers who work at Amazon or used to function there, speak with them to recognize what the society resembles. The Leadership Concepts we reviewed above can provide you a feeling of what to anticipate, however there's no replacement for a discussion

Mock Coding Interviews – How To Improve Your Performance

Statistics & Probability Questions For Data Science Interviews


with an insider. We would also suggest taking a look at the list below resources: As stated over, you'll have to respond to 3 kinds of concerns at Amazon: coding, system design, and behavioral. Here is a summary of the approach: Step 1: Ask clarification inquiries Recognize the goal of the system(e.g. market ebooks) Establish the scope of the workout(e.g. end-to-end experience, or just API?) Gather range and performance needs(e.g. 500 purchases per secondly) Reference any kind of presumptions you're constructing loud Action 2: Design at a high degree after that pierce down Lay out the top-level elements (e.g. Play the function of both the candidate and the recruiter, asking inquiries and answering them, just like two individuals would certainly in an interview. By on your own, you can not replicate assuming on your feet or the pressure of performing in front of a stranger. Plus, there are no unanticipated follow-up concerns and no comments. That's an ROI of 100x!. Variety and String Adjustment: Learn strategies for sorting, searching, and rearranging varieties and strings. Dynamic Programs: Research study usual patterns like memoization and tabulation.

How To Handle Multiple Faang Job Offers – Tips For Candidates

Chart Issues: BFS, DFS, Dijkstra's formula, and more. Binary Trees and Heaps: Concentrate on traversal, insertion, and deletion formulas. Backtracking and Recursion: Get comfortable with troubles that need exploring different opportunities.

Chart Issues: BFS, DFS, Dijkstra's formula, and a lot more. Binary Trees and Tons: Focus on traversal, insertion, and removal formulas. Backtracking and Recursion: Get comfy with troubles that require checking out various opportunities.

Back-end Engineering Interview Guide – What To Expect

The Best Machine Learning Interview Prep Courses For 2025


Graph Troubles: BFS, DFS, Dijkstra's formula, and much more. Binary Trees and Tons: Concentrate on traversal, insertion, and removal algorithms. Backtracking and Recursion: Get comfy with issues that need checking out different opportunities.

Microsoft Software Engineer Interview Preparation – Key Strategies

Chart Problems: BFS, DFS, Dijkstra's algorithm, and a lot more. Binary Trees and Loads: Focus on traversal, insertion, and removal formulas. Backtracking and Recursion: Get comfortable with troubles that call for checking out different possibilities.

How To Succeed In Data Engineering Interviews – A Comprehensive Guide

How To Get Free Faang Interview Coaching & Mentorship


Chart Issues: BFS, DFS, Dijkstra's formula, and more. Binary Trees and Plenty: Concentrate on traversal, insertion, and deletion formulas. Backtracking and Recursion: Obtain comfortable with problems that need discovering various opportunities.

The Best Free Websites To Learn Data Structures & Algorithms

Graph Problems: BFS, DFS, Dijkstra's algorithm, and much more. Binary Trees and Lots: Emphasis on traversal, insertion, and deletion algorithms. Backtracking and Recursion: Obtain comfy with problems that require exploring different possibilities.

Graph Issues: BFS, DFS, Dijkstra's formula, and a lot more. Binary Trees and Heaps: Concentrate on traversal, insertion, and deletion algorithms. Backtracking and Recursion: Obtain comfy with issues that require discovering various opportunities.